On Wed, 22 Dec 1999, Clement wrote:
> I need to accept proxy logins from Ascend's Navis Radius server. Does
> anyone know what NasType I should use in the client section?
>
You should not use NasType with a proxy Radius server. The NasType is used by
the Session Database to verify logins and has no relevance to a proxy (indeed
this will probably cause failures with SNMP or finger or whatever).
> I tried without any NasType setting and resulted in a log of Attribute
> unknown errors like this.
>
> Wed Dec 22 15:53:52 1999: ERR: Attribute number 195 (vendor 529) is not
> defined in your dictionary
>
This is because you are seeing packets from an Ascend (vendor 529) that is
using the new Ascend code that supports vendor specific attributes correctly.
There is a file called "dictionary.ascend2" in the patches area that defines
these attributes:
http://www.open.com.au/radiator/downloads/patches-2.14.1/
> Also can I control the number of concurrent users through that Navis
> Radius server?
Yes - this is a function of the corresponding AuthBy (DefaultSimultaneousUse).
